EULAR3DS is a robust three dimensional space marching code for computing steady state solutions to the Euler equations applied to external flows. The code solves the integral equations of motion in a finite volume sense and is thus totally conservative. The algorithm used is called the ALPHA-scheme and was developed by the author for this code. This scheme is explicit with either first or second order accuracy and is constructed by splitting the fluxes on cell faces to account for upwind signal propagation. The code solves the governing equations using either a perfect gas model or an equilibrium air gas model due to Srinivasan Ref. 1. There are six options regarding the grid generation schemes employed and the code is fully compatible with QUICK geometry modelling system. The purpose of this document is to describe the code in a manner that will familiarize the user with the codes options and structure and enable relatively painless usage of the code.
